5.

FLASHCARD QUESTION

Front

This trade barrier limits the number of products that can be brought into a country.

Back

Quota

6.

FLASHCARD QUESTION

Front

This is a tax on imports that is used to increase price of foreign products and raise government revenue.

Back

tariff

7.

FLASHCARD QUESTION

Front

This is the most restrictive of the trade restrictions a nation can use to close off all importation of a product.

Back

embargo
